Choosing the right folding walking pad for a small office involves considering several factors beyond just size. You want a model that fits seamlessly into your workspace, offers reliable performance, and remains easy to store away when not in use. Understanding these key considerations can help prevent common mistakes, like opting for a device that’s too small to be effective or too bulky to store easily.Size and Foldability
In a small office, space is at a premium. Look for models that fold into a compact size and are lightweight enough to move around easily. Some models fold flat, while others may require detaching certain parts for storage. Consider your available space and how often you’ll need to fold or unfold the device to ensure it fits your workflow comfortably.
Performance and Speed
While many small office walking pads prioritize compactness, performance still matters. Check the motor power and maximum speed—ideally, it should support a comfortable walking pace without feeling underpowered. Be wary of models that max out at very low speeds if you plan to use the device for light exercise or stretching during work hours.
Ease of Storage and Portability
Ease of storage is key in tight spaces. Features like lightweight frames, foldable designs, and built-in handles make a significant difference. Consider how the device will fit into your existing storage options—whether under a desk, in a closet, or against a wall—and whether it’s convenient to set up when needed.
Additional Features
Features like remote control, incline settings, LED displays, and quiet operation can enhance usability. However, more features usually come with higher costs and complexity. Decide which extras are necessary—if you want a device mainly for walking during work, simplicity might be best. For more active use, incline and remote control could justify a higher price.
Budget and Value
Pricing varies significantly based on features and build quality. Focus on models that strike a good balance between cost and functionality. Beware of very cheap options that may lack durability, but also avoid overspending on features you won’t use. Reading reviews and comparing warranties can help gauge the long-term value of your investment.
Frequently Asked Questions
Will a small office walking pad be loud enough to disturb coworkers?
Most modern folding walking pads designed for office use operate quietly enough to avoid disturbing others, especially those with noise-reducing motors. However, the level of noise can vary, so checking user reviews for sound levels is advisable. If noise is a concern, opt for models specifically marketed as quiet or whisper-quiet, which often incorporate sound-dampening features.
Can I use a folding walking pad while working at my desk?
Yes, many models are designed specifically for under-desk use, allowing you to walk while working. Look for models with a low profile, non-slip surface, and adjustable speed settings that allow for a gentle pace suitable for typing or reading. Ensure your desk height and the walking pad’s dimensions are compatible for comfortable use without obstructing your workspace.
How much space do I need to store a folding walking pad in a small office?
The amount of space varies by model, but most compact options fold into a size that can fit under a desk, behind a door, or in a closet. Typically, you’ll need around 3-4 square feet of space when stored. Consider your storage options and whether you prefer a model that folds flat or one that can be easily carried to a closet or corner when not in use.
Are folding walking pads durable enough for daily use?
Many models are built with durable materials intended for regular use, but longevity depends on build quality and proper maintenance. Higher-end models often feature reinforced frames and quality motors that support daily walking. Reading user reviews for durability insights and checking warranty coverage can help ensure your investment lasts over time.
What features should I prioritize if I want a device mainly for light walking during work?
If your goal is light walking during work, prioritize models with a low maximum speed, quiet operation, and easy foldability for storage. Simplicity and reliability are key—features like remote control and sturdy handles add convenience without complicating use. Avoid overly complex models with unnecessary features that might increase cost or setup time.
